Following the completion of major refurbishments to Charleville Town Park & Playground, plans are progressing to install a new pedestrian crossing on Park Road, Cork North West Fine Gael General Election candidate Councillor John Paul O’Shea has confirmed.
Refurbishment of the playground was completed during the summer and included extensive refurbishment of the existing playground as well as new play equipment, new surfacing, enhanced accessibility, sensory equipment, seating and perimeter fencing.
This week, Cllr. O’Shea said: “The current pedestrian crossing is old and unsafe. The new crossing will make it much safer for all users of Charleville Town Park. Cork County Council is currently preparing plans through Section 38 of the Planning and Development Act and will be seeking the public’s feedback on the proposed pedestrian crossing shortly.”
